I haven’t used my MT01 much during the past 18 months, but
yesterday put it back on the road, and found after a 50 mile
ride that I had a leaking fork oil seal. I noticed that the
damping of the front suspension felt poor, with potholes & poor
road surfaces feeling really harsh and underdamped.
After 18 years it’s clear that the forks & rear shock would
benefit from a refurbishment, but instead of simply fitting new
fork seals & fork oil, can anyone recommend a worthwhile
suspension upgrade? What about Andreani adjustable cartridge
kits? Any advice and thoughts would be welcome
Does anyone have any experience of this fork upgrade. Also what
about fitting a progressive spring to the rear shock assembly?

Unfortunately as you’ve commented the ÖHLINS forks are
completely unobtainable now, easier to find rocking horse sh!t
After getting some positive feedback about Andreani products,
I’ve taken the plunge & ordered a set of Andreani Misano Evo
adjustable hydraulic cartridges for the MT01. The spring rate is
matched to the rider, so I had to weigh myself (not a pleasant
activity after far too many pies consumed in recent months
🥧), and order the springing for a fat basta*d which
Andreani could offer :D
I’ll let everyone know the results when they are fitted in the
next few weeks
